Trying to handle a connected client socket in a new thread from global thread pool:
m_threadPool = QThreadPool::globalInstance();
void TCPListenerThread::onNewConnection()
{
QTcpSocket *clientSocket = m_tcpServer->nextPendingConnection();
clientSocket->localPort();
m_connectThread = new TCPConnectThread(clientSocket);
m_threadPool->start(m_connectThread);
}

class TCPConnectThread : public QRunnable {
TCPConnectThread::TCPConnectThread(QTcpSocket *_socket)
{
m_socket = _socket;
this->setAutoDelete(false);
}
void TCPConnectThread::run()
{
if (! m_socket->waitForConnected(-1) )
qDebug("Failed to connect to client");
else
qDebug("Connected to %s:%d %s:%d", m_socket->localAddress(), m_socket->localPort(), m_socket->peerAddress(), m_socket->peerPort());
if (! m_socket->waitForReadyRead(-1))
qDebug("Failed to receive message from client") ;
else
qDebug("Read from client: %s", QString(m_socket->readAll()).toStdString().c_str());
if (! m_socket->waitForDisconnected(-1))
qDebug("Failed to receive disconnect message from client");
else
qDebug("Disconnected from client");
}
}

I have been getting endless errors with these. It seems cross-thread QTcpSocket
handling is not feasible(See Michael's answer).
一些错误:
QSocketNotifier: socket notifiers cannot be disabled from another thread
ASSERT failure in QCoreApplication::sendEvent: "Cannot send events t objects owned by a different thread.

If you want to handle an incoming connection as a new QTcpSocket object in another thread you have to pass the socketDescriptor to the other thread and create the QTcpSocket object there and use its setSocketDescriptor() method.

To do this, you'll have to inherit from QTcpServer
and override the virtual method incomingConnection
.

Within that method, create the child thread which will create a new QTcpSocket
for the child socket.
例如:
class MyTcpServer : public QTcpServer
{
protected:
virtual void incomingConnection(int socketDescriptor)
{
TCPConnectThread* clientThread = new TCPConnectThread(socketDescriptor);
// add some more code to keep track of running clientThread instances...
m_threadPool->start(clientThread);
}
};
class TCPConnectThread : public QRunnable
{
private:
int m_socketDescriptor;
QScopedPointer<QTcpSocket> m_socket;
public:
TCPConnectionThread(int socketDescriptor)
: m_socketDescriptor(socketDescriptor)
{
setAutoDelete(false);
}
protected:
void TCPConnectThread::run()
{
m_socket.reset(new QTcpSocket());
m_socket->setSocketDescriptor(m_socketDescriptor);
// use m_socket
}
};
